117.info
人生若只如初见

hbase hdfs集群如何搭建

搭建HBase与HDFS集群是一个复杂的过程,涉及多个步骤和组件的配置。以下是一个基本的搭建流程,以及相关的注意事项和建议:

搭建流程

  1. 环境准备:确保所有机器之间网络互通,可以通过主机名ping通。在所有机器上安装配置JDK,版本大于等于1.8。在所有机器上安装配置Hadoop,版本大于等于2.7。在所有机器上安装配置ZooKeeper,版本大于等于3.4。
  2. 下载和安装HBase:从Apache官网下载HBase安装包,并解压到指定目录。
  3. 配置HBase
    • 设置环境变量。
    • 配置hbase-env.sh指定JDK和Hadoop的安装位置。
    • 配置hbase-site.xml,包括设置为分布式集群、指定ZooKeeper的地址、HBase数据存储的HDFS路径等。
  4. 配置HDFS
    • 在所有机器上配置core-site.xmlhdfs-site.xml,确保HDFS集群的正确运行。
    • 格式化NameNode并启动HDFS集群。
  5. 启动HBase:在HMaster节点上运行start-hbase.sh启动HBase集群。

注意事项和建议

  • 在配置HBase与HDFS集成时,确保hbase.rootdir指向正确的HDFS路径。
  • 根据实际硬件配置和网络状况,调整Hadoop和HBase的内存分配和垃圾回收参数,以优化性能。
  • 定期监控集群状态,及时处理可能出现的故障或性能问题。

通过以上步骤,你可以搭建一个基本的HBase与HDFS集群。请注意,这只是一个基础流程,实际部署可能需要根据具体需求和环境进行调整。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e67cAzsKAwZTA1M.html

推荐文章

  • HBase如何存储Parquet格式

    HBase是一个基于列的NoSQL数据库,它允许用户以非结构化和半结构化数据的形式存储大量数据
    要将Parquet格式的数据存储到HBase中,您需要执行以下步骤: 安装...

  • HBase Region数据迁移

    HBase Region数据迁移是指将HBase中的Region从一个RegionServer迁移到另一个RegionServer的过程,这个过程涉及到多个步骤和注意事项。以下是HBase Region数据迁移...

  • HBase Region和表关系

    HBase中的Region是表的一个物理分区,也是HBase表中的一个逻辑分区,用于存储表中的数据。以下是关于HBase Region和表关系的详细解释:
    HBase Region和表的...

  • HBase Region的生命周期

    HBase中的Region生命周期是指Region从创建到销毁所经历的一系列阶段。了解Region的生命周期有助于我们更好地理解HBase的工作原理和性能优化。
    HBase Region...

  • hbase hdfs安全如何保障

    HBase和HDFS是大数据生态系统中的两个关键组件,它们通过一系列安全措施来保障数据安全。以下是它们如何保障数据安全的详细说明:
    HBase和HDFS的安全保障措...

  • hbase hdfs空间如何管理

    HBase是一个基于Hadoop的分布式、可扩展的NoSQL数据库,它利用HDFS作为底层存储系统,提供高效的随机读写和海量数据管理的能力。以下是关于HBase与HDFS空间管理的...

  • hbase hdfs读写如何实现

    HBase是一个基于Hadoop的分布式、可扩展的非关系型数据库,它允许用户在HDFS(Hadoop Distributed File System)上存储和查询大量稀疏数据 安装和配置HBase:

  • hbase hdfs故障如何排除

    当遇到HBase与HDFS的故障时,可以采取以下步骤进行故障排除:
    HBase-HDFS故障排除步骤 检查HBase服务状态 使用jps命令确认HBase服务是否正常运行。
    检...